Is Windsor Labour Or Conservative?

Windsor (/ˈwɪnzə/) is a constituency in Berkshire represented in the House of Commons of the UK Parliament since 2005 by Adam Afriyie of the Conservative Party.

Is Maidenhead still conservative?

Since its creation at the 1997 general election, the seat has been held by Conservative Member of Parliament Theresa May who served as Home Secretary from 2010 to 2016 and as Prime Minister from 2016 to 2019. It is considered a safe seat for the Conservative Party.

Who won the last general election?

The Conservatives won 365 seats, their highest number and proportion of seats since 1987, and recorded their highest share of the popular vote since 1979; many of their gains were made in long-held Labour seats, dubbed the ‘red wall’, which had registered a strong ‘Leave’ vote in the 2016 EU referendum.

Is Canterbury conservative or Labour?

Canterbury is a constituency in Kent represented in the House of Commons of the UK Parliament since 2017 by Rosie Duffield of the Labour Party.

Is Kent considered Greater London?

The present metropolitan county of Greater London constitutes nearly all of the historic county of Middlesex (which comprises the bulk of Greater London north of the River Thames), parts of the historic counties of Kent, Essex, and Hertfordshire, and a large part of the historic county of Surrey.

How many London boroughs are conservative?

They hold 21 of 73 London seats in the House of Commons and 8 of 25 seats in the London Assembly. The party controls 7 of 32 London boroughs, and won 508 out of the 1,851 Councillors in the 2018 local elections. The party held the Mayoralty of London from 2008 until losing to Labour in 2016.

Which party is Slough Council?

Labour has held a majority of the seats on the council since 2008, and the leader of the council since 2017 has been Labour’s James Swindlehurst. The post of mayor is largely ceremonial in Slough and tends to be held by a different councillor each year.

Why do they call it Maidenhead?

Maidenhead’s name stems from the riverside area where the first “New wharf” or “Maiden Hythe” was built, as early as Saxon times.

When was Labour last in power?

A global recession in 2008–10 led to Labour’s defeat in the 2010 election. It was replaced by a Conservative-Liberal Democrat coalition government, headed by David Cameron, that pursued a series of public spending cuts with the intention of reducing the budget deficit.

Is Windsor a posh area?

Poshest of all is Old Windsor. Property runs the gamut from castles to Victorian terraces. Clarence Road and around is full of lovely period town houses; Park Street as close as you can get to HRH; Eton is more impressive, though, architecturally.

What type of area is Windsor?

Windsor is a historic market town and unparished area in the Royal Borough of Windsor and Maidenhead in Berkshire, England. It is the site of Windsor Castle, one of the official residences of the British monarch.

Is Windsor a London borough?

The Royal Borough of Windsor and Maidenhead is a Royal Borough of Berkshire, in South East England. It is named after both the towns of Maidenhead and Windsor, the borough also covers the nearby towns of Ascot and Eton. It is home to Windsor Castle, Eton College, Legoland Windsor and Ascot Racecourse.

Who owns Windsor Assembly?

Stellantis Canada
Windsor Assembly Plant (WAP) is a Stellantis Canada automobile factory in Windsor, Ontario. The factory opened in 1928 and Chrysler minivans production began in 1983. Windsor Assembly is Windsor’s largest employer. The plant currently operates two shifts with over 4,200 employees.
